Latest Patents

Warita's patent is titled "Navigation Server." This invention focuses on rapidly generating guide support information considering the traffic state after an accidental situation arises in a road section. The system estimates the changing pattern of cumulative traffic volume following an incident and provides the necessary information for navigation devices to adjust accordingly. This advancement aims to enhance driver awareness and improve navigation efficiency during critical situations.
